想起十年前建站时,我们买了几台服务器,抬着去电信托管机房安装。而现在的站长应该很少机会见到机房了。现在一切都上云,云端开发已经是主流了。但国内云厂商如此多,我们该如何选择呢?本文选择了国内具有代表性两家云提供商——阿里云和华为云,从多个角度进行了比较,谨供读者参考。
1.价格
多数人首先关心的是价格。阿里云和华为云的服务器不完全一样,比较起来不一定很准确,笔者只能尽自己最大能力去公平地比较价格。为了公平起见,这里选择了三个同为华北地区一样核数一样内存大小的弹性云服务器(ECS)。这三个云的配置分别为2核2G,4核16G,8核32G,我相信这些配置应该可以满足小微创业公司起步阶段的需求。价格[1][2]比较如下表:
网上评价都说华为云性价比高,不过就笔者亲自比较的结果来说,虽然华为云每小时单价确实要划算些,但月价和年价阿里云还是相对便宜点。如果作为开发者短期使用,华为云可能耗费更少,但作为企业长期使用来讲,选择阿里云会划算点。
2.性能
理论上性能上同样配置的云直观感受感受其实是差不多的,但还是有很多测评指标可以参考。
在听云发布的《2018中国云计算性能洞察报告》[3]中,阿里云的CPU系统性能评分为1.88分,稍低于华为云的2.08分,华为云在系统性能方面确实下了不少功夫。可是在Stolen CPU usage这一项里,阿里云可以说是领先太多。首先解释下,Stolen CPU usage是评测CPU隔离性能的指标,得分越高,说明CPU得离得越好,资源互相占用情况就越少,性能也就越稳定。在Stolen CPU usage这项中,阿里云得分2.5分,华为云仅0.42分。说明华为云的服务器可能会存在CPU资源隔离方面的问题。这也是为啥业界认为阿里云要稳定得多的原因之一。华为云得在这方面加把劲了,希望能看到华为云在2019年的测评报告中把这项得分提高些。
3.海外节点
目前阿里云在海外十二个城市有节点,分别是香港,新加坡,悉尼,吉隆坡,雅加达孟买,东京 ,硅谷,弗吉尼亚,法兰克福,伦敦,迪拜。
华为云海外有节点的城市有六个,分别是香港 ,曼谷 ,新加坡 ,约翰内斯堡 ,巴黎 ,亚特兰大。
在海外节点的选择范围上,阿里云的选择还是要多些的。
4.业界评价
业界评价其实带有主观色彩,但我们还是可以从他人反馈的实际体验,还有成功案例等多方面来去参考下的。就目前的水准和多年实际成功案例而言,阿里云领先华为云太多。阿里云是自研的,淘宝和天猫就是基于阿里云的,经受了多年实际业务的考验,每年双11的压力都被阿里云一次次都扛下来了。华为云基于开源项目OpenStack,其实也是借OpenStack开源、标准API的特点,来向大型国企和政府来推广,但目前成功案例不多。在同行评价里,阿里云口碑要好些。
结语
其实早在今年9月份,阿里就将核心系统100%上云,悄悄运行了2个月,而消费者却毫无感知,这背后体现了云的稳定性。阿里双十一今年的交易额创新高,从2009年的5200万到今年的2684亿,超过5000倍的销售额增长,背后离不开阿里云的架构支持。毕竟“卖货还得自己用”,双11就是阿里云的最好代言。然华为云内部也说过要三年内赶超阿里云,但就目前的情况来讲,我认为阿里云在国内地位还是短期内无法撼动的。如果要选云,目前阿里云还是最佳选择。
网址链接: https://www.itnav123.com/sites/257.html